About Yardyly

Unified Scheduling & Dispatch

Yardyly features a dynamic, drag-and-drop scheduling interface that allows managers to visually plan and optimize employee routes and job assignments with seamless efficiency. This central calendar provides a complete operational overview, enabling quick adjustments for last-minute changes, weather delays, or new bookings. The system facilitates intelligent resource allocation, ensuring the right crew and equipment are assigned to the right job at the right time, thereby maximizing daily productivity and reducing fuel costs from inefficient routing.

Integrated Customer Management (CRM) & Booking

The platform includes a robust Customer Relationship Management (CRM) system that consolidates all client interactions, service history, notes, and preferences in one secure profile. This is directly linked to an online booking portal, allowing potential and existing customers to request services or schedule appointments 24/7. This integration streamlines the client intake process, automates appointment confirmations and reminders, and builds a valuable knowledge base for delivering personalized, high-quality service that fosters customer loyalty and repeat business.

Financial Operations & Invoicing

Yardyly provides comprehensive financial tracking tools that cover the entire monetary workflow of a landscaping business. From generating and sending professional, branded invoices directly from a completed job entry to tracking client payments and managing supplier contracts, all fiscal data is centralized. This module ensures precise financial control, simplifies accounts receivable, offers clear insights into profitability per job or client, and integrates with payment gateways for faster, more convenient transactions.

Real-Time Project Coordination & Communication

The software offers dedicated tools for real-time project oversight, allowing managers to track job status, budget adherence, and on-site progress from their dashboard. Coupled with features for efficient support ticketing and direct client feedback incorporation, this ensures issues are resolved swiftly and service quality is continuously improved. Furthermore, built-in communication channels enhance team collaboration by keeping field crews connected with the office, receiving updates, and accessing job details instantly via mobile devices.

Yardyly

Scaling a Solo Landscaping Operation

For a solo operator or a very small team, Yardyly acts as a virtual office manager and dispatcher. It automates the time-consuming tasks of quoting, scheduling, invoicing, and payment follow-up. The professional online booking presence attracts new clients, while the mobile app allows the owner to manage the day's route, update job statuses, and send invoices from the field, effectively enabling one person to manage all business aspects without being tied to a desk.

Optimizing Fleet and Crew Management for Growing Businesses

As a landscaping company expands its fleet and hires more crew members, coordination becomes complex. Yardyly addresses this by providing a master operational dashboard. Managers can assign jobs based on crew skill sets and location, track vehicle and equipment usage, and monitor daily productivity. The clear insights help in identifying bottlenecks, optimizing routes to save on fuel and time, and ensuring labor and resources are utilized at peak efficiency across multiple concurrent projects.

Enhancing Client Service and Retention

Businesses focused on building a premium brand use Yardyly to elevate the customer experience. The CRM stores detailed service histories, enabling personalized care (e.g., noting a client's preference for organic fertilizer). Automated reminders for seasonal services, easy online re-booking, and a direct channel for feedback make clients feel valued. The swift, organized handling of any service issues through the ticketing system turns potential problems into opportunities to demonstrate reliability and commitment.

Streamlining Financial Administration and Reporting

For business owners needing clear financial insight, Yardyly consolidates all monetary transactions. Instead of juggling bank statements, paper invoices, and spreadsheet ledgers, everything from client payments to material supplier costs is logged in the platform. This allows for easy generation of profit/loss reports, understanding which services are most profitable, tracking outstanding invoices, and having organized, digital records ready for tax season or financial planning.

About Yardyly

Yardyly is a comprehensive, cloud-based business management platform engineered explicitly for the landscaping, lawn care, and outdoor service industries. It functions as an all-in-one digital operations hub, designed to replace the fragmented systems—such as spreadsheets, paper notes, and disparate software applications—that commonly plague service businesses. The core value proposition of Yardyly lies in its ability to consolidate essential tools into a single, intuitive interface, thereby providing business owners with unparalleled clarity and control over their daily operations. The platform is built to scale, catering to solo entrepreneurs just starting their venture as well as established companies managing growing teams and complex schedules. By centralizing online booking, job scheduling, customer relationship management (CRM), invoicing, payment processing, and team coordination, Yardyly automates repetitive administrative tasks, reduces manual data entry, and significantly improves communication with both field crews and clients. Its mobile-friendly design ensures that critical business functions—like managing routes, updating job statuses, checking schedules, and tracking revenue—are accessible from anywhere, whether in the office or on-site from a truck. Ultimately, Yardyly empowers business owners to cultivate success by minimizing time spent on chaotic logistics and maximizing time dedicated to core competencies: creating beautiful outdoor spaces and strategically growing their enterprise.

Yardyly FAQ

Is Yardyly suitable for a one-person landscaping business?

Absolutely. Yardyly is explicitly designed to scale with a business, starting from its very foundation. For a solo operator, it eliminates administrative chaos by integrating scheduling, client management, and invoicing into one affordable tool. The automation of bookings, reminders, and invoicing saves countless hours, allowing the sole proprietor to focus on hands-on work and business growth without needing an administrative assistant.

How does Yardyly handle communication with field crews?

Yardyly enhances team coordination through its mobile-accessible platform. Job details, schedules, client notes, and route information are pushed directly to crew members' devices. They can update job statuses (e.g., "in progress," "completed"), add notes, or request clarification in real-time. This reduces phone calls and miscommunication, ensures everyone is working from the latest information, and provides managers with immediate visibility into field operations.

Can clients book and pay for services online?

Yes, a core feature of Yardyly is its client-facing functionality. Businesses can embed or link to a professional online booking portal where clients can view available services, request quotes, and schedule appointments at their convenience. Furthermore, the integrated invoicing system allows businesses to send digital invoices that include secure online payment options, facilitating faster payments and improving cash flow.

Is my business data secure with Yardyly?

Yardyly prioritizes data security and reliability. The platform employs industry-standard SSL (Secure Sockets Layer) encryption to protect all data in transit between users and the cloud servers. As a cloud-based service, it also ensures that data is securely backed up and accessible from any authorized device. The company adheres to high trust standards, providing a secure and risk-free environment for managing sensitive business and customer information.
